The official website of Jordan's treasury was sabotaged on Monday by Israeli computer hackers who placed an image of a black hand inscribed with the lyrics of Israel's national anthem on its homepage.
The hacker group, who identified itself as the "Blue and White Team", is believed have responded to a wave of sabotage against more than 200 Israeli websites by a Moroccan group who identify themselves as "Team Evil", according to Haaretz.
Another group who identified themselves as Turkish has been thought to be responsible for the sabotage of at least 17 Israeli websites, most recently placing a cartoon of US President George Bush whose head had been replaced by the of Israeli Prime Minister Ariel Sharon.
This sort of hacking is apparently not held with high regard as other types are by hackers, since it requires pre-prepared software and attacks sites with minimal security.
